Output 580b393bd196977bc1286b19699b413d155cdbffa037f89122ac1b49856101d0:1

value
7562038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3847626200690ca33abf0b365d24c3a345abfea6 OP_EQUALVERIFY OP_CHECKSIG
address
168aMcSyAKHn3abCUs5WwseYFWAh42MFRA
transaction
580b393bd196977bc1286b19699b413d155cdbffa037f89122ac1b49856101d0
confirmations
599014
spent
true